Chicago Fire's South Loop Stadium: A Major Development for the City

Chicago is buzzing with excitement! The proposed new stadium for the Chicago Fire Football Club, slated for the South Loop, promises to be more than just a sporting venue; it's poised to become a major catalyst for economic development and community revitalization. This ambitious project represents a significant step forward for the city, and its impact will be felt far beyond the pitch.

A New Home for the Fire: For years, the Chicago Fire have lacked a dedicated, state-of-the-art stadium, playing in various borrowed venues. This has hampered the team's ability to cultivate a strong home-field advantage and fully engage with its passionate fanbase. The new South Loop stadium aims to rectify this, providing a modern, purpose-built facility equipped to host MLS matches, concerts, and other large-scale events. This will solidify the Fire's position in Chicago's sporting landscape and create a vibrant hub for the city's soccer community.

Economic Impact and Job Creation: The construction and operation of the stadium are expected to generate thousands of jobs, both during the construction phase and afterward. This injection of economic activity will benefit local businesses and contribute significantly to the city's overall economic growth. Furthermore, the increased foot traffic and tourism associated with the stadium are projected to boost revenue for surrounding businesses, creating a ripple effect throughout the South Loop neighborhood.

Revitalization of the South Loop: The stadium's location in the South Loop is strategically chosen to contribute to the ongoing revitalization of this dynamic area. The development is planned to integrate seamlessly with the surrounding community, incorporating green spaces, improved public transportation access, and potentially even affordable housing initiatives. This holistic approach ensures that the stadium's positive impact extends beyond just the immediate vicinity, fostering a vibrant and inclusive neighborhood.

Community Engagement and Accessibility: Developers are emphasizing community engagement throughout the planning and construction phases. This includes extensive consultations with local residents to address concerns and ensure the project aligns with the needs of the community. Plans also prioritize accessibility, with provisions for individuals with disabilities and efforts to ensure the stadium is easily accessible via public transportation. This commitment to inclusivity will solidify the stadium's role as a community asset.

Concerns and Challenges: While the project holds immense potential, challenges remain. Concerns about traffic congestion, parking availability, and the potential displacement of residents require careful consideration and proactive solutions. Transparent communication with the community is crucial to address these concerns and build consensus.

The Future of Chicago Soccer: The Chicago Fire's new South Loop stadium represents a significant investment in the future of soccer in Chicago. It is a project that promises to not only elevate the team's performance but also to contribute positively to the city's economy, community development, and overall quality of life. The successful completion of this project will serve as a model for future stadium developments and highlight Chicago's commitment to fostering a vibrant sporting and cultural scene.
